A Comprehensive Guide to Establishing Large-Scale Monitoring Systems227


In an increasingly technology-driven world, organizations rely heavily on complex IT infrastructures to support critical operations. To ensure the seamless functioning of these systems, effective monitoring is paramount. Large-scale monitoring systems play a crucial role in providing real-time visibility into the performance and health of IT environments, enabling proactive troubleshooting and optimizing operations.

Establishing a large-scale monitoring system requires a structured approach that encompasses various components and considerations. This guide will provide a comprehensive overview of the key steps involved in building a robust and effective monitoring system:

1. Define Monitoring Objectives

Before embarking on any implementation, it is essential to clearly define the objectives of the monitoring system. Consider the specific requirements of your organization, including:
Coverage: Determine the scope and depth of monitoring required for all critical components.
Metrics: Identify the key performance indicators (KPIs) and metrics necessary to monitor system health and performance.
Alerts and Notifications: Establish thresholds and criteria for triggering alerts and notifications to ensure timely response to issues.

2. Select Monitoring Tools

The choice of monitoring tools is crucial for the success of the monitoring system. Consider the following factors when selecting tools:
Functionality: Ensure the tools provide the necessary functionality to monitor the desired metrics and components.
Scalability: Choose tools capable of handling the size and complexity of your IT environment.
Integration: Select tools that integrate seamlessly with your existing infrastructure and applications.

3. Implement Monitoring Agents

Monitoring agents are software components that collect data from target systems and devices. They play a vital role in providing real-time insights into system performance. Consider the following guidelines when deploying monitoring agents:
Agent Placement: Determine the optimal placement of agents to ensure comprehensive coverage.
Agent Configuration: Properly configure agents to collect the desired metrics and forward data to the monitoring console.
Agent Maintenance: Establish a process for regular agent updates and maintenance to ensure accuracy and security.

4. Establish Centralized Monitoring Console

A centralized monitoring console serves as a single point of control for managing and monitoring all components of the system. It provides a consolidated view of data from various agents, enabling efficient analysis and troubleshooting.
Dashboard Design: Design intuitive dashboards that provide clear and actionable insights into system performance.
Data Analysis: Utilize advanced data analysis techniques to identify trends, patterns, and potential issues.
Alert Management: Configure alerts and notifications to ensure timely response to critical events.

5. Integrate with Other Systems

For comprehensive monitoring, it is often necessary to integrate the monitoring system with other systems, such as:
Ticketing Systems: Integrate with ticketing systems to automate issue tracking and resolution.
Configuration Management Tools: Sync with configuration management tools to track changes and ensure compliance.
Log Management Systems: Centralize log data from various sources for advanced analysis and correlation.

6. Establish Monitoring Processes

Effective monitoring requires the establishment of well-defined processes, including:
Monitoring Schedules: Set up regular monitoring schedules to ensure continuous data collection.
Incident Response: Establish clear procedures for responding to system issues and outages.
Performance Optimization: Regularly review and optimize monitoring configurations to enhance performance and efficiency.

7. Train and Empower Teams

The success of the monitoring system relies heavily on the knowledge and skills of the team responsible for its operation. Ensure that team members receive adequate training on:
Monitoring Tools: Provide thorough training on the functionality and usage of monitoring tools.
Incident Management: Train teams on incident response procedures and best practices.
Data Analysis: Empower teams with data analysis skills to identify patterns and trends.

Conclusion

Building a large-scale monitoring system is a complex undertaking that requires careful planning, implementation, and ongoing maintenance. By following the steps outlined in this guide, organizations can establish robust monitoring systems that provide valuable insights into the health and performance of their IT environments. With a proactive approach to monitoring, organizations can ensure seamless operations, minimize downtime, and optimize the performance of their critical systems.

2024-10-21


Previous:Setting Up Remote Network Monitoring

Next:How to Set Up Surveillance Cameras